Number of stillbirths in Norway
Norway: Number of stillbirths was 104 in 2023. ▼ Falling
Number of stillbirths in Norway, 2000–2023
Source: Estimates developed by the UN Inter-agency Group for Child Mortality Estimation (UNICEF, WHO, World Bank, UN DESA Population Division) at www.childmortality.org.
Analysis
Norway recorded 104 for number of stillbirths in 2023. That is the lowest value across all 24 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 1.9% on the previous year and down 34.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, number of stillbirths in Norway peaked at 220 in 2000 and was at its lowest, 104, in 2023.
Norway ranks 150th of 195 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 24 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 187.7 | 175 | 220 | 10 |
| 2010s | 154 | 130 | 176 | 10 |
| 2020s | 113 | 104 | 121 | 4 |
